Common Compounds in Natural Zepbound Recipes (like Berberine, Inulin, Chromium)

The power of any natural zepbound recipe lies in its ingredients. These natural compounds work in synergy to mimic the effects of pharmaceutical GLP-1 receptor agonists by reducing appetite, balancing blood sugar, and supporting fat metabolism.

Here are the key players:

1. Berberine

  • Found in plants like barberry, goldenseal, and tree turmeric
  • Shown to lower blood glucose levels and enhance insulin sensitivity
  • Often compared to metformin in function but entirely natural

Berberine can regulate AMPK (a metabolic master switch), helping your body burn fat more efficiently. It also reduces cravings by controlling the glucose-insulin response.

2. Inulin

  • A prebiotic fiber extracted from chicory root, Jerusalem artichoke, and garlic
  • Helps regulate gut bacteria and increases satiety
  • Slows digestion of carbs to prevent insulin spikes

Inulin is often added to natural Zepbound drinks as a powder or blended with foods like bananas or asparagus for better gut health and weight control.

3. Chromium Picolinate

  • A trace mineral that enhances insulin action
  • Often found in broccoli, sweet potatoes, and whole grains
  • Helps stabilize blood sugar, reducing hunger and energy crashes

Chromium plays a critical role in glucose regulation, making it a valuable addition to any recipe that targets metabolic balance.

Tips for Safe Usage and Natural Optimization

How to Avoid Side Effects of DIY Zepbound Recipes

While a natural zepbound recipe is generally safer than prescriptions, it’s still important to be smart about usage. Some ingredients—like berberine or inulin—can cause mild digestive upset if overused.

Smart tips:

  • Start with half doses to test tolerance
  • Avoid taking it on an empty stomach if you’re sensitive
  • Don’t mix with prescription meds without medical guidance
  • Take breaks every 4–6 weeks to let your body reset

Always listen to your body. “Natural” doesn’t mean “risk-free.”
